Friday, May 18, 2007


Today's Economist also features a graph which depicts patents per capita, according to that graph Japan is the most innovative economy, followed by Switzerland, the Scandinavians and Germany. That is all very well, but I doubt that those patents always feed forward into economic growth. I couldn't find Britain in that table though.

